The ingredients needed to make Banana Pudding Cake with Cream Cheese fluff icing:

  1. Take 1 box French vanilla cake mix
  2. Take 3 eggs
  3. Get 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  4. Get 1 cup milk
  5. Make ready 1-4 serving box instant banana cream pudding
  6. Make ready 1 jar Beechnut banana baby food
  7. Take 1 cup crushed mini Nila Wafers
  8. Get 8 oz cream cheese
  9. Get 1 jar marshmallow fluff
  10. Take 1 cup powdered sugar
  11. Prepare Extra Nila Wafers for garnish

Steps to make Banana Pudding Cake with Cream Cheese fluff icing:

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Grease and lightly flour 2 - 9"round cake pans, or place liners in regular size cupcake tins. (Recipe yields a dozen cupcakes, and 1 - 9" round cake perfectly)
  2. In a large bowl, add cake mix, eggs, oil, milk, and pudding mix. Beat for 2 minutes on medium speed using an electric mixer. Stir in banana baby food, and crushed wafers until combined.
  3. Evenly distribute the cake batter into prepared cake pans or cupcake tins. Bake in oven for 25-30 minutes or until toothpick comes out clean. (If making cupcakes, use approximately 1/3 cup batter per cupcake)
  4. While cakes are cooling, mix cream cheese, marshmallow fluff and powdered sugar in a large bowl until shiny and smooth.
  5. Dip each cooled cupcake into the icing or pour and spread icing over the cooled cakes. Use any remaining Nila Wafers as garnish. Enjoy!
